How about making the gnome-panel give away its focus to the newly
created window? Within the gnome-panel, it should be pretty obvious
which actions should give away the focus and which should not. I do not
know, how easy to implement it is, though.

That's pretty difficult for a launcher - how does the panel know that
the launcher is going to create a window vs which is not?  And how does
it know what window it is?  If you click on the firefox launcher, it
runs a shell script.  That script (may) eventually run an X
application, but it in itself isn't one.  What's the launcher telling
the wm in that case under your proposed model?
